Childrearing Style
The manner in which parents raise their children, including authoritative, authoritarian, permissive, and uninvolved styles, each with different impacts on child development.
Abraham Maslow
An American psychologist best known for creating Maslow's hierarchy of needs, a theory of psychological health predicated on fulfilling innate human needs in priority, culminating in self-actualization.
Personality Theorists
Scholars and researchers who study and develop theories about the psychological traits and mechanisms that make up individual personalities.
Childrearing
The practices, strategies, and methods used by caregivers to support and promote the development of a child.
